Output 71f18bcb9f3c35923f43abfc85b52a6d9e03b3041317f002f639ff77dfeda7a9:1

value
142632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e39b81c3455e4d55cf3f6375ecee602bb35b8a7 OP_EQUAL
address
37N2xqTE3fadJrgzLkvL9raj6EAJb9gyWK
transaction
71f18bcb9f3c35923f43abfc85b52a6d9e03b3041317f002f639ff77dfeda7a9
spent
true